A review of smart homes- present state and future challenges
Marie Chan1, Daniel Estève, Christophe Escriba
1LAAS-CNRS, 7, avenue du Colonel Roche, F-31077 Toulouse, France. chan@laas.fr
Smart homes utilize intelligent devices and sensors for continuous monitoring, offering mobility assistance and disease prevention for the elderly and disabled. These advanced systems enhance well-being and combat social isolation without disrupting daily life.
Area of Science:
- Gerontology
- Assistive Technology
- Ubiquitous Computing
Background:
- Information technology enables intelligent devices for monitoring the elderly and disabled.
- Sensors in homes provide continuous mobility assistance and non-obtrusive disease prevention.
- Smart homes address social isolation and enhance well-being for individuals with reduced physical functions.
Purpose of the Study:
- To present a selection of international smart home projects.
- To discuss associated technologies like wearable/implantable monitoring systems and assistive robotics.
- To explore future challenges in the smart home domain for enhanced living.
Main Methods:
- Review of international smart home projects.
- Analysis of wearable/implantable monitoring systems.
- Examination of assistive robotics integrated into smart home environments.
Main Results:
- Smart homes offer non-intrusive assistance, improving comfort and well-being.
- Integrated technologies support mobility and disease prevention.
- Assistive robotics function as key components within smart home ecosystems.
Conclusions:
- Smart home technology significantly benefits the elderly and disabled by enhancing independence and quality of life.
- The integration of monitoring systems and robotics is crucial for comprehensive smart home solutions.
- Addressing future challenges will further optimize smart home applications for societal well-being.
